For those of you who know, I have been worrying about a knocking sound that the 327 in the Chevelle has been making, and had not gone away. Once the sound started, i would BARELY run it, but no matter what it knocked. With the little time that I have had recently I decided to use that to finish up sme other things on the car first. Thinking the worst me and my buddy Brian started tearing into it yesterday. Come to find out the valve lash was WAY off. It was adjusted once, but I dont know what happened. Other than that, a real good tune on the carb and adjustment of the timing and the thing is really running excellent! Just hoping that the lifters werent too tight and started messing up the cam, but no "glitter" in the oil was found. Only if it were nice out I could have taken it out and done wasted some BFG's. Now onto fixing the rear (the pinion angle is too high at 2* up) instead of around 4* down. Thats just an adjustment of the control arms.
